Thoughts on leasing & drilling activity ...

"But [Patrick] Courreges adds that the lull chiefly comes from all the recent action in north Louisiana’s Haynesville Shale area, where millions have been invested to get a piece of what’s expected to become the nation’s top producing natural gas field within the next six years. “What you’re seeing now is folks are spending their money on getting their sites ready and are drilling, instead of buying more leases,” Courreges says.
